    A clove hitch is fast, but also the number one reason fenders are lost while the boat is unattended because any movement and jostling can work the knot loose. When leaving the boat for longer periods, and especially if the boat is moving around at the dock, use a round turn and two half hitches.

    The small pop up cleat used the video is intended to be only used for the fender and is not rated for mooring. If on your own vessel you need to share the mooring cleat then we would recommend you set your fender on the cleat first at the correct height and then the mooring line can be attached or removed as required without being obstructed. If the cleat has a mid-section gap use the demonstrated knot on the bow rail to attach the fender to the cleat. That will help keep the ends of the cleat available to wrap the mooring line onto.
